Parallel Verses

New American Standard Bible

My heart has been smitten like grass and has withered away,
Indeed, I forget to eat my bread.

King James Version

My heart is smitten, and withered like grass; so that I forget to eat my bread.

Holman Bible

My heart is afflicted, withered like grass;
I even forget to eat my food.

International Standard Version

Withered like grass, my heart is overwhelmed, and I have even forgotten to eat my food.

A Conservative Version

My heart is smitten like grass, and withered, for I forget to eat my bread.

American Standard Version

My heart is smitten like grass, and withered; For I forget to eat my bread.

Amplified


My heart has been struck like grass and withered,
Indeed, [absorbed by my heartache] I forget to eat my food.

Darby Translation

My heart is smitten and withered like grass; yea, I have forgotten to eat my bread.

Julia Smith Translation

My heart was struck and dried up as grass, that I forget eating my bread.

King James 2000

My heart is smitten, and withered like grass; so that I forget to eat my bread.

Lexham Expanded Bible

My heart is struck like grass and withers. Indeed, I forget to eat my bread.

Modern King James verseion

My heart is stricken, and dried like grass, so that I forget to eat my bread.

Modern Spelling Tyndale-Coverdale

My heart is smitten down, and withered like grass, so that I forget to eat my bread.

NET Bible

My heart is parched and withered like grass, for I am unable to eat food.

New Heart English Bible

My heart is blighted like grass, and withered, for I forget to eat my bread.

The Emphasized Bible

Smitten like herbage, so is my heart dried up, For I have forgotten to eat my food.

Webster

My heart is smitten, and withered like grass; so that I forget to eat my bread.

World English Bible

My heart is blighted like grass, and withered, for I forget to eat my bread.

Youngs Literal Translation

Smitten as the herb, and withered, is my heart, For I have forgotten to eat my bread.

Context Readings

Affliction In Light Of Eternity

3 For my days have been consumed in smoke,
And my bones have been scorched like a hearth.
4 My heart has been smitten like grass and has withered away,
Indeed, I forget to eat my bread.
5 Because of the loudness of my groaning
My bones cling to my flesh.
